Leslie is joined by two guests and callers as she discusses the Republican controlled House beginning the 115th Congress with a fiasco that had them first voting to gut the House Ethics Committee during a secret vote, only to reverse course the following day thanks to immense pressure from the public.

Leslie's first guest during the hour was Bob Ney, a former Ohio Congressman who was directly involved in the scandal that led to the eventual formation of the current independent House Ethics Committee. He gives his unique perspective on the matter. Our second guest of the hour is Jonah Minkoff-Zern, Co-director of Public Citizen’s Democracy Is For People campaign.

Jonah discusses how the public pressure that led to House Republicans reversing course on gutting the Ethics Committee could be used as a road-map for future victories against the GOP Congress and President-Elect Trump. His Twitter handle is @JonahMZ.
